    What to do if no sound is heard from Sharp HT-SB60 Home Theater System?
    • B
      Bobby JacksonAug 20, 2025
      If you are not hearing any sound from your Sharp Home Theater System, first ensure that the input signal is set correctly. Then, check that the volume level is not set to 'Min' and increase it if necessary. Also, verify that muting is deactivated. Finally, confirm that you are using HDMI compliant equipment and that the HDMI cable is connected correctly. Avoid connecting or disconnecting an HDMI cable whilst power is on, as this may lead to operation problems.

    Why Sharp HT-SB60 Home Theater System remote control does not operate properly?
    • D
      Diane HarveyAug 22, 2025
      If the remote control for your Sharp Home Theater System isn't working properly, start by checking if the battery polarity is correct and correct it if needed. If that doesn't work, replace the battery if it's dead. Ensure that there are no obstructions in front of the sound bar and eliminate any strong light shining on the remote sensor. Also, make sure the remote control is not used for another equipment simultaneously. Finally, adjust the distance and angle for proper operation.

    How to turn on Sharp Home Theater System if the power is not turned on?
    • J
      jose21Aug 28, 2025
      If the power of your Sharp Home Theater System is not turning on, ensure that the sound bar is plugged in. If it still doesn't turn on, the protection circuit may be activated. In this case, unplug and plug in the power lead again after 5 minutes or more.

    Why background noise appears when connecting Sharp Home Theater System with RCA audio output?
    • L
      luceroaliciaAug 30, 2025
      If you are experiencing background noise when connecting your Sharp Home Theater System with an RCA audio output terminal from a TV-set/ DVD/ Blu-ray Disc Player, this may occur depending on the TV/DVD/Blu-ray Disc Player's brand, model, and age, and it is not a sound bar problem. Please change to HDMI/ARC or headphone terminal from TV-Set/ DVD/Blu-ray Disc Player.
